When we decide what kind of person we want to be, it is important to surround ourselves with people who are better than us. The Bible talks about role models and the importance of having them; it talks about the first role models in our lives - our parents. Role models show us how to handle strengths, gifts, and even weaknesses; they teach us how to live out the most important calling in our life - to be a Saint! The greatest role model that ever existed was Jesus! It is important to surround ourselves with Jesus, to learn about Jesus, see how Jesus acted and reacted, and become like that. God the Father and Mother Mary taught Jesus and they were His role models; they can be ours too.

Our words and actions are also constantly influencing others. Here’s how we can be the best role models to others:

  1. Be Aware of Ourselves
  2. Be Positive
  3. Be Humble
  4. Be Empathetic
  5. Be a Person of Integrity
  6. Be like Jesus

We were created to change the world; we were created to be history-makers but, the reality is that very few of us bring about a change in the world. We live in a time when there are many open doors, and many exciting opportunities, but many continue to live in a “dream”. God wants us to live this life to the fullest but many of us have big “BUTS”. The big and massive “buts” stop us from achieving greatness.

God has an incredible plan for our lives. Here are a few tips to get rid of your big “buts”:

  1. Find Your Center of Gravity
  2. Get Your ‘But’ to the Ground
  3. Get Back Up Again

When fear controls our plans, “Do It Scared”! We can achieve the greatness God has planned for us when we step forward in spite of our fears, trusting in Him.

Will our pets go to Heaven? In order to answer this, we need to understand what exactly is Heaven. As Catholics, we believe that there is Heaven, Hell, and Purgatory - all places that we go to when we die. Heaven is more than just a physical place that is a fantasy; it is beyond earthly concepts like space and time. Heaven is a place where our hearts beat with the heartbeat of God; it is a state of being where only God matters, and we are lost in the unconditional love of God.

So, are animals instrumental in helping us understand this unconditional love? They continue to love us and give us attention when we hurt them or avoid them. St. Thomas Aquinas said that animals don’t go to Heaven but Fr. Rob Galea is unsure about this. Humans were created for Heaven and animals were created for this world to help humans achieve Heaven.

Our vocation, as humans, is to see animals and recognize Jesus in God’s creation; we see His unconditional love through them. Heaven is about being sold out for God and our happiness is not dependent on our pets being or not being there.

Are stress and anxiety wearing you down? Fr. Rob Galea shares a few tips to find joy and hope even when you are stressed or anxious. Discover the secret to having joy and hope! To find this, we need to plan ahead; even in those moments when we are not overwhelmed with anxiety. Pressure from the world, expectations from social media lifestyle, and the realities of life are a few reasons for the stress causing us to be lonely and unhappy.

We were created for peace and we have the power to live in constant peace and joy. In all the confusion and chaos, we need to do is throw our hands up to Jesus and ask Him to pick us up so that we can see the world from His hands and through His eyes. Here are a few tips to deal with stress:

  1. Recognize and acknowledge the problem
  2. Get the help you need from your friends, family, and even medical professionals
  3. Reach out to God in prayer
  4. Meditate on the Word of God
  5. Worship the Lord with the community
  6. Exercise

El Gibbor - God of Breakthrough - wants to break through the stress in our lives.

Have you ever asked: “Did Jesus really exist?” In this episode, we explore the “historicity” of Jesus. Philosopher Bertrand Russell said that it was doubtful whether Christ existed and that if He did, we do not know anything about Him. Roman historian, Tacitus, writes about Jesus and His crucifixion. Flavius Josephus, a Jew, also wrote about Jesus and His crucifixion. Many others after them also wrote about the Nazarene who performed miracles. Not just historians, we also have the Bible - a book full of references to history to help us understand Christ who was part of history and is still alive today.

He existed fully human and fully divine; He rose from the dead! There is historical evidence of Jesus' existence through his disciples, through books, and even nature! To us, He is more than a historical figure; we have a relationship with the living God by speaking and listening to Him. Let’s dive deeper into knowing Jesus Christ and develop a relationship with Him.
